Bristol Rovers vs Notts County Preview: Crucial Match Analysis and Predicted Lineup
Bristol Rovers are gearing up for a critical encounter against Notts County as they aim to break a seven-match losing streak in League Two. They currently hover just two points above the relegation zone, making this match crucial for their standings as the festive season approaches.
Bristol Rovers’ Strategy Against Notts County
Coach Darrell Clarke has indicated a strategic shift by deploying a 3-5-2 formation in their recent match against Cheltenham Town. Despite losing that game due to a late goal, the Rovers demonstrated significant offensive capability, registering 17 shots on goal.
Key Players to Watch
- Luke Southwood The goalkeeper returned from international duty with Northern Ireland. His performance against Cheltenham was solid, and he is expected to start again.
- Macauley Southam-Hales: The right wing-back impressed with his crossing ability, and his offensive contributions will be crucial against Notts County.
- Stephan Negru, Tom Lockyer, and Clinton Mola: This defensive trio will aim to contain the threats posed by the Magpies.
Midfield Dynamics and Attack Strategy
Midfielders Kamil Conteh, Alfie Chang, and Joel Cotterill are anticipated to start again. This trio proved effective in controlling play against Cheltenham, with Cotterill showing particular promise in offense.
In the attacking department, Fabrizio Cavegn and Ellis Harrison are poised to lead the line. Rovers will look to capitalize on their physicality and skill to pose a significant threat to the Notts County defense.
Projected Starting XI
Based on the recent performances and strategic needs, this is the predicted lineup for Bristol Rovers:
| Position | Player |
|---|---|
| GK | Luke Southwood |
| CB | Stephan Negru |
| CB | Tom Lockyer |
| CB | Clinton Mola |
| RWB | Macauley Southam-Hales |
| LWB | Jack Sparkes |
| CM | Kamil Conteh |
| CM | Joel Cotterill |
| CM | Alfie Chang |
| FW | Fabrizio Cavegn |
| FW | Ellis Harrison |
